Flutter中的按钮组件虽然没有单独的Button Widget,但提供了多种Child Button Widget,如 RaisedButton、FlatButton 等。这些按钮大多继承自 MaterialButton,而后者是对 RawMaterialButton 的封装。其绘制和填充依赖于 ConstrainedBox 组件。按钮组件功能 按钮组件具备多种功能,如响应点击事件、显示反馈提示等。不同的按钮...
一个圆形图标按钮,它悬停在内容之上,以展示应用程序中的主要动作。FloatingActionButton通常用于Scaffold.floatingActionButton字段 效果: 文档:https://api.flutter.dev/flutter/material/FloatingActionButton-class.html
Flutter 中的 FloatingActionButton 是一个圆形的浮动操作按钮,通常用于在移动应用中提供一个快速、突出的操作入口。 基本用法 FloatingActionButton 最基本的用法是提供一个点击事件的回调,并添加一个子 Widget 作为按钮内容,通常是一个图标。 dart FloatingActionButton( onPressed: () { // 当按钮被按下时执行的操...
Scaffold(// 设置悬浮按钮floatingActionButton:FloatingActionButton(onPressed:(){print("悬浮按钮点击");},child:Text("悬浮按钮组件"),),) 完整代码示例 : 代码语言:javascript 代码运行次数:0 运行 AI代码解释 import'package:flutter/material.dart';classStatefulWidgetPageextendsStatefulWidget{@override _StatefulWi...
Flutter 中FloatingActionButton是用来实现悬浮按钮效果的 class ScffoldHomePage extends StatefulWidget { @override State<StatefulWidget> createState() { return ScffoldHomePageState(); } } class ScffoldHomePageState extends State<ScffoldHomePage> { ///当前选中的页面 num index =0; @override Widget build...
Flutter基础widgets教程-FloatingActionButton篇 1 FloatingActionButton FloatingActionButton(FAB) 控件是一个纸墨设计中定义的 FAB 按钮。用来显示界面上的主要功能。 2 构造函数 代码语言:javascript 复制 FloatingActionButton({Key key,this.child,this.tooltip,this.foregroundColor,this.backgroundColor,this.heroTag...
FloatingActionButton 简称 FAB,从字面理解可以看出,它是“可交互的浮动按钮”,其实在Flutter默认生成的代码中就有这家伙,只是我们没有正式的接触。 一般来说,它是一个圆形,中间放着图标,会优先显示在其他Widget的前面。一般可以实现浮动按钮,也可以实现类似闲鱼 app 的底部凸起导航 。
现在的出现的问题是FloatingActionButton位置不对,内容被部分遮挡了,第一想到就是添加SafeArea避免被遮挡,但是没有效果;(我猜想Scaffold类似一个Stack组件而FloatingActionButton是一个Position组件) 打开Android Studio的Flutter Inspector查看FloatingActionButton布局后的数据也就是查看top,bottom,width,height;但没有找到top...
一、Flutter FloatingActionButton介绍 FloatingActionButton简称FAB,,可以实现浮动按钮,也可以实现类似闲鱼app的底部凸起导航 属性名称*属性值* child子视图,一般为Icon,不推荐使用文字 tooltipFAB被长按时显示,也是无障碍功能 backgroundColor背景颜色 elevation未点击的时候的阴影 ...
flutter floatingActionButton悬浮按钮控件 import'package:flutter/material.dart';voidmain() { runApp( MaterialApp( title:'Flutter gesture', home: LearnFloatingActionButton(), )); }classLearnFloatingActionButton extends StatefulWidget{ @override State<StatefulWidget>createState() {return_LearnFloatingAction...